Are you a skilled Program Specialist who loves focusing on Customer Success? This Program Specialist (Customer Success) will liaise with customer and technical teams and become a subject matter expert of OIT’s products and services with the goal of supporting the IT Director team and ultimately generating customer satisfaction among state agencies. The Program Specialist will be passionate about solving customer needs and able to effectively communicate OIT’s value story. This person will be a servant leader, a strong communicator, analytical, and skilled at creating and maintaining collaborative relationships across OIT’s matrixed organization. Some of your important daily responsibilities will include: Create and cultivate collaborative customer relationships with internal OIT teams with the intent to understand the business of OIT, serve as a liaison between internal teams and the Customer Office in an effort to better serve agency customers; and be familiar with OIT’s services in order to help communicate OIT’s value story. Become a subject matter expert of OIT’s billing model, service codes, and product offerings. This position may provide customer billing consulting services to other internal and external stakeholders and executives. Identify gaps in process and communication to improve collaboration across the OIT disciplines in order to improve service to customers. Support the OIT IT Director team by providing proactive, across-agency support, support of OIT and agency WIGs, IT Transformation and backup and a bench for potential future IT leadership that would increase continuity of OIT service and presence across-agencies. Triage, manage and track first tier tactical operational support for agencies as directed. Support Customer Office initiatives as directed by the OIT IT Directors, Senior IT Directors, and the Chief Customer Officer.

If this posting indicates “remote from anywhere in CO” in the title, periodic reporting to the primary state work location designated for the position is required. All remote work must be performed in Colorado. While candidates from out of state will be considered for this role, the candidate selected for the position must relocate and reside in Colorado on the first day of their new position. There is no form of relocation assistance, financial or otherwise, available for any position. A reasonable timeframe for relocation will be established on an individual basis, while considering business needs, and determining a start date.
